Section 60: Form and manner of ascertaining details of inward supplies

Maharashtra Goods and Services Tax Rules, 2017.State Rules of Maharashtra · 2017

(1) The details of outward supplies furnished by the supplier in FORM GSTR- 1 2[or FORM GSTR-1A] or using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) shall be made available electronically to the concerned registered persons (recipients) in Part A of FORM GSTR-2A, in FORM GSTR-4A and in FORM GSTR-6A through the common portal, as the case may be.

(2) The details of invoices furnished by an non-resident taxable person in his return in FORM GSTR-5 under rule 63 shall be made available to the recipient of credit in Part A of FORM GSTR-2A electronically through the common portal.

(3) The details of invoices furnished by an Input Service Distributor in his return in FORM GSTR- 6 under rule 65 shall be made available to the recipient of credit in Part B of FORM GSTR-2A electronically through the common portal.

(4) The details of tax deducted at source furnished by the deductor under sub-section (3) of section 39 in FORM GSTR-7 shall be made available to the deductee in Part C of FORM GSTR-2A electronically through the common portal

(5) The details of tax collected at source furnished by an e-commerce operator under section 52 in FORM GSTR-8 shall be made available to the concerned person in Part C of FORM GSTR 2A electronically through the common portal.

(6) The details of the integrated tax paid on the import of goods or goods brought in domestic Tariff Area from Special Economic Zone unit or a Special Economic Zone developer on a bill of entry shall be made available in Part D of FORM GSTR-2A electronically through the common portal.

(7) An ![auto-generated] statement containing the details of input tax credit shall be made available to the registered person in FORM GSTR-2B, for every month, electronically through the common portal, and shall consist of -

(i) the details of outward supplies furnished by his supplier, other than a supplier required to furnish return for every quarter under proviso to ! For the words “auto-drafted”, the words “auto-generated” were substituted by Notification No. GST.1022/C.R.41 (1) / Taxation-1 (Second Amendment-2022, Notification No.19/2022), dated 13th October 2022 (w. e.f. 1st’ day of October, 2022).

144 sub-section (I) of section 39, in FORM GSTR-1, between the day immediately after the due date of furnishing of FORM GSTR-1 for the previous month to the due date of furnishing of FORM GSTR-1 for the month;

(ii) the details of invoices furnished by a non-resident taxable person in FORM GSTR-5 and details of invoices furnished by an Input Service Distributor in his return in FORM GSTR-6 and details of outward supplies furnished by his supplier, required to furnish return for every quarter under proviso to sub-section (1) of section 39, in FORM GSTR- 1 or using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F), as the case may be,-

(a) for the first month of the quarter, between the day immediately after the due date of furnishing of FORM GSTR-1 for the preceding quarter to the due date of furnishing details using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) for the first month of the quarter;

(b) for the second month of the quarter, between the day immediately after the due date of furnishing details using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) for the first month of the quarter to the due date of furnishing details using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) for the second month of the quarter;

(c) for the third month of the quarter, between the day immediately after the due date of furnishing of details using the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) for the second month of the quarter to the due date of furnishing of FORM GSTR-1 for the quarter;

(iii) the details of the integrated tax paid on the import of goods or goods brought in the domestic Tariff Area from Special Economic Zone unit or a Special Economic Zone developer on a bill of entry in the month.

(8) The Statement in FORM GSTR-2B for every month shall be made available to the registered person,-

(i) for the first and second month of a quarter, a day after the due date of furnishing of details of outward supplies for the said month, in the invoice furnishing facility (IFF) by a registered person required to furnish return for every quarter under proviso to sub-section (I) of section 39, or in FORM GSTR-1 by a registered person, other than those required to furnish return for every quarter under proviso to sub-section (I) of section 39, whichever is later;

(ii) in the third month of the quarter, a day after the due date of furnishing of details of outward supplies for the said month, in FORM GSTR-1 by a registered person required to furnish return for every quarter under proviso to sub-section (1) of section 39.]
